Sign and Lighting Retro Fit:

Another service we offer that applies to both signs and lighting is what we call a lighting retro fit. This opportunity involves switching out your current lighting fixtures and components, and replacing them with high efficiency versions. In addition to improved performance, these new updates entail huge cost savings by drastically cutting energy consumption each month, as well as requiring significantly less frequent replacement. What’s more, you might not even have to pay for the whole job yourself, as many power companies are offering generous subsidies to organizations that make the switch.
